Schneider Electric 490NRP95400: Industrial Data Link for Modicon Smart Factory Networks

The Schneider Electric 490NRP95400 is a purpose-built Modbus Plus Network Repeater engineered to extend and reinforce the data backbone of industrial automation environments. In modern smart factory architectures, where field devices, PLC controllers, remote I/O modules, HMI panels, SCADA systems, variable frequency drives, and intelligent sensors must exchange real-time data without interruption, the integrity of the communication network is mission-critical. The 490NRP95400 addresses this challenge directly by regenerating and amplifying the Modbus Plus signal, enabling longer cable runs and more robust peer-to-peer communication across the plant floor.

Designed to integrate seamlessly within Schneider Electric’s Modicon automation ecosystem, this repeater supports the high-speed, deterministic token-passing protocol of Modbus Plus — a network architecture that has proven its reliability across decades of industrial deployment. Whether connecting a Modicon M340 or Modicon Quantum PLC to distributed I/O racks, linking a TSX Momentum adapter to upstream controllers, or bridging segments of a plant-wide Modbus Plus backbone, the 490NRP95400 ensures that data flows without degradation, latency spikes, or packet loss.

Solving Data Isolation in Industrial Sites

One of the most persistent challenges in industrial automation is data isolation — the condition where field devices, controllers, and supervisory systems operate in silos, unable to share information efficiently. The Schneider Electric 490NRP95400 directly addresses several root causes of this problem in Modbus Plus environments.

Protocol Fragmentation: Many plants operate a mix of Modbus RTU, Modbus Plus, and Ethernet-based devices. The 490NRP95400, used in conjunction with Modbus Plus-to-Modbus RTU gateways or Ethernet bridges, allows legacy serial devices to participate in the broader network without requiring costly hardware replacement. This preserves the value of existing instrumentation while enabling unified data collection at the SCADA level.

Network Distance Limitations: Modbus Plus is limited to 450 meters per segment without signal regeneration. In large facilities — refineries, automotive assembly plants, water treatment stations — this constraint can force engineers to redesign network topology or accept degraded communication quality. The 490NRP95400 eliminates this constraint, allowing up to five repeaters in series and extending the total network reach to over 1,800 meters while maintaining full protocol compliance and deterministic timing.

Remote Monitoring and Diagnostics: With the 490NRP95400 maintaining a stable Modbus Plus backbone, remote diagnostic tools can reliably poll every node on the network. Maintenance engineers can use Schneider Electric’s Unity Pro or EcoStruxure Control Expert software to perform online diagnostics, monitor communication statistics, and identify faulty nodes without physical access to the field panel. This capability is essential for reducing mean time to repair (MTTR) and supporting predictive maintenance strategies.

Industrial Connectivity FAQ

Q1: What is the maximum network extension achievable with the 490NRP95400?
A: The 490NRP95400 allows up to five repeaters to be used in series on a single Modbus Plus network, extending the total cable length from 450 meters (one segment) to over 1,800 meters across multiple segments. Each segment supports up to 32 nodes, and the repeater itself counts as a node on each segment it connects.

Q2: Is the 490NRP95400 compatible with both Modicon Quantum and Modicon M340 platforms?
A: Yes. The 490NRP95400 is fully compatible with all Modbus Plus-capable Modicon platforms, including Modicon Quantum, Modicon M340 (via Modbus Plus adapter), Modicon Premium, and TSX Momentum I/O adapters. It operates transparently on the network without requiring configuration — simply insert it into the cable run at the appropriate point.

Q3: How does the 490NRP95400 affect network communication latency?
A: Signal regeneration by the 490NRP95400 introduces negligible latency — typically less than one token rotation cycle. Modbus Plus operates at 1 Mbit/s with a deterministic token-passing protocol, and the repeater does not alter the token rotation sequence or add processing delay. Network scan times remain consistent with or without the repeater in the segment.
